GAMEONE Holdings (08282) announced that its wholly-owned subsidiary, Hangzhou GAMEONE Artificial Intelligence Co., Ltd., has been officially recognized as a Hangzhou Headquarters Enterprise for 2025. The designation follows a review process conducted by the Hangzhou Municipal Development and Reform Commission, which recently released its list of approved companies for the year.
Serving as the Group's core headquarters platform in mainland China, Hangzhou GAMEONE leverages the city's strengths in artificial intelligence and e-commerce to advance the Group's initiatives in AI and gaming integration, trade services, and cybersecurity technology.
As a result of the headquarters enterprise status, Hangzhou GAMEONE has secured a multi-year credit facility of RMB 9 million from China Construction Bank. The loan carries an annual interest rate of 2.5%, is unsecured, and offers flexible repayment terms, supporting the Group's efforts to optimize its financing structure and cash flow management.
The recognition is expected to enable Hangzhou GAMEONE to benefit from related support policies and resource allocations offered by the Hangzhou municipal government for headquarters enterprises. This is anticipated to enhance the Group's brand influence and market competitiveness in mainland China, contributing positively to its overall financial position and operational performance.
